Output 856877f4fb7b62b83935773a45849cc4ed97968e64435ce0f0c67761057ff6c7:5

value
1627527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d15dc7ee7458ea6bb4d3599d96a87e5685c6946f OP_EQUAL
address
3Ln3VeqbZDVTQaayaw9TGbC5745TXNFWRE
transaction
856877f4fb7b62b83935773a45849cc4ed97968e64435ce0f0c67761057ff6c7
spent
true